Mount Dora is widely known for its antiques where people from all over the state, country, and world travel to see. Valuable nostalgic items lie within the quaint shops, just steps from old, quiet country inns. Mount Dora is also home to many lakes, a historic railroad station and features one of three freshwater lighthouses in Florida which are all visible from the downtown area.
